The Bosch Rexroth Indramat RECO-E.00/01 is part of the RECO Drive Modules series and functions as an expansion rack with eight slots. Designed for use on a TS 35 x 27 x 15 DIN rail, it features an INTERBUS Remote Bus fieldbus interface and allows a maximum bus segment length of 400 meters. The rack provides IP20 protection and supports a supply cable cross-section of 2.5 mm².

Product Description:

The RECO-E.00/01 is an expansion rack in the RECO Drive Modules series from Bosch Rexroth Indramat. It serves as a passive carrier for plug-in I/O and communication assemblies, extending drive-based automation with a shared backplane for signals and diagnostics. In factory systems, it lets motion controllers or inverters be expanded in a modular manner, keeping wiring short and supervision centralized.

The rack communicates with higher-level controllers through the INTERBUS Remote Bus, a serial fieldbus that transfers process data and diagnostic messages in a token-passing ring. Internal synchronization between the inserted modules is handled by a Bus Board that forms the local bus medium, eliminating separate ribbon cables and reducing assembly time. A single bus segment may span 400 m, so cabinets distributed along a production line can be tied together without repeaters. When multiple segments are linked into a closed topology, the permissible ring length rises to 12.8 km, supporting large factory installations. Hardware capacity is fixed at 8 slots, allowing orderly placement of power, logic, and relay cards while keeping signal paths consistent.

For physical installation, the frame clips onto a TS 35 × 27 × 15 DIN rail, so existing control panels that follow EN 50022 profiles can accept the assembly without extra brackets. Environmental protection is limited to IP20, meaning live parts must be mounted inside a closed enclosure when dust or liquid exposure is possible. Supply conductors up to 2.5 mm² can be routed to the integrated terminal strip. The rack does not include a power supply, so an external 24 V source must feed the backplane. Operation is permitted in areas where occasional relative humidity reaches 85% with no condensation, and the rack can be stored at 75% relative humidity without moisture buildup.
